Базы данных Функции СУБД Ранние подходы к организации БД Проектирование реляционных БД Cтруктуры внешней памяти Язык реляционных баз данных SQL Компиляторы SQL СУБД в архитектуре "клиент-сервер" Объектно-ориентированные СУБД

Лекция 2. Функции СУБД. Типовая организация СУБД. Примеры

Как было показано в первой лекции, традиционных возможностей файловых систем оказывается недостаточно для построения даже простых информационных систем. Мы выявили несколько потребностей, которые не покрываются возможностями систем управления файлами: поддержание логически согласованного набора файлов; обеспечение языка манипулирования данными; восстановление информации после разного рода сбоев; реально параллельная работа нескольких пользователей. Можно считать, что если прикладная информационная система опирается на некоторую систему управления данными, обладающую этими свойствами, то эта система управления данными является системой управления базами данных (СУБД).